TRI-COUNTY NORTH LOCAL SCHOOL DISTRICT



The meeting of the Tri-County North Board of Education was held on Monday, September 21, 2020 at 7:30 p.m. in the High School Lecture Room.

This is a meeting of the Board of Education in public and is not to be considered a public community meeting.

D. Bill Derringer Superintendent

• See Attachment

• First employee tested positive for COVID in the elementary. Out for 14 days from last week.

• Notified parents via One Call and a letter that was posted on our website and sent out via FinalForms

• Affected two students as well

• New updates on Board Policies

• Title IX requirements

• Broadband - $60,586.47

• MOU – Mental Health Board – funding of $10,600.00 to the school
